Biography
Fujita practiced freestyle wrestling in high school. He participated in the FILA World Championships as a junior in 1988, placing sixth, and in the Espoir division in 1989, placing eleventh. In 1993, Fujita placed fifth at the Asian Championships at the senior level, and in 1993 and 1994, he represented Japan as a senior in the World Cup, a dual meet tournament. He was also a national champion in Japan in Greco-Roman wrestling.

Awards & Accolades

  • Extreme Shootout: 2000 Extreme Shootout - The Underground Tournament Winner
  • Fight Matrix: 2000 Rookie of the Year
  • PRIDE Fighting Championships: 2000 PRIDE Openweight Grand Prix Semi-Finalist
  • Inoki Genome Federation: IGF Championship (1 time)
  • New Japan Pro-Wrestling: IWGP Heavyweight Championship (3 times)
  • New Japan Pro-Wrestling: Singles Best Bout (2005) vs. Masahiro Chono on August 14
  • Nikkan Sports: Fighting Spirit Award (2000)
  • Pro Wrestling Noah: GHC National Championship (1 time)
  • Pro Wrestling Noah: GHC Heavyweight Championship (1 time)
  • Strong Style Pro-Wrestling: Legend Championship (1 time)
  • Tokyo Sports: Match of the Year (2001) vs. Yuji Nagata on June 6, 2001
  • Tokyo Sports: Rookie of the Year (1997)
